Marine Weather HF Voice Broadcast for the Gulf of Mexico

Seas given as significant wave height, which is the average
height of the highest 1/3 of the waves. Individual waves may be
more than twice the significant wave height.

Synopsis for the Gulf of Mexico

.SYNOPSIS...The pressure gradient between high pressure centered
over Florida and lower pressures in the western Gulf will
support moderate to fresh winds over the majority of the Gulf of
Mexico well into next week. Fresh to locally strong winds will
pulse at night through the period near the northern and western
Yucatan Peninsula due to a thermal trough.
